On Tue, 2002-08-13 at 11:11, Tom Lane wrote: > Gavin Sherry <swm@linuxworld.com.au> writes: > > I'm thinking that temporary views should be pretty trivial to > > implement. > > ... except not so trivial, per the rest of your note. > > Do we actually need any such feature? Views on temp tables already work > correctly in CVS tip: the implicit DROP CASCADE on temp tables at > backend exit makes such views go 'way too. I was playing with this a while back (when I had initially added CASCADE to tables). I believe that in the event of a crash the temp tables are not removed until their next use. This means that stale *real* items may litter the system but the temp table no longer exists in these rare occurrences. However, having all temporary items removed during backend startup would remove this case.
